- Description
- The United States Department of Energy, National Nuclear Security Administration (NNSA), Y-12 Site Office (YSO) intends to contract by means other than full and open under the provisions of 41 U.S.C. ??253(c)(1) and FAR 6.302-1, Only One Responsible Source and No Other Supplies or Services Will Satisfy Agency Requirements. YSO intends to negotiate an short-term extension to the current contract, DE-AC05-02OR22928, with Wackenhut Services, Inc., for the physical protection of Government assets at the Y-12 National Security Complex (Y-12 NSC) through its paramilitary protective force. This action is to extend for up to three months a contract which has been in place since July 2002 and is scheduled to expire June 30, 2006. The extension will be for one month with two consecutive one-month options. The estimated value of this contract extension, including options, is $22,000,000. A full and open competitive solicitation for award of a contract to provide Protective Force (ProForce) Security Services was issued in November 2005. A new contract award is anticipated in the summer of 2006, but there is not sufficient time to award the new Pro Force contract and complete transition activities before the current contract expires. The scope of work for this contract extension includes Protective Force Operations, including a paramilitary force; Information Security; Technical Surveillance Countermeasures; Personnel Security Clearances; Human Reliability Program; and Technical Support. The contractor will provide fully armed and unarmed paramilitary protective force services at the Y-12 NSC and the Central Training Facility. These services include protection of special nuclear material, personnel, classified and unclassified documents, Government property and facilities, and the staffing of 24-hour central alarm stations (CAS) and secondary alarm stations (SAS). The contract includes providing canine support, trained and qualified in explosives, narcotics and human presence detection; security movement of special nuclear material; and performance testing. The contract includes managing and operating the Central Training Facility and providing a certified training program to meet training requirements for both new personnel and required annual training. The use of other than full and open competition for the proposed actions is authorized by 41 USC ??253(c)(1). This section provides that when the supplies and services required by the agency are available from only one responsible source, a contract may be awarded without full and open competition. Because of the short term nature of this bridge contract, only the incumbent contractor may provide the require services. The time required to receive the necessary security clearances; hire the over 500 ProForce personnel; accept and/or re-negotiate the Collective Bargaining Agreement; and establish a comparable benefits program that includes a defined pension benefit would exceed the period of performance of the bridge contract. Firms that want to challenge the sole-source nature of this action must submit a letter and other information that demonstrates your firm???s ability to provide an equivalent service and rationale as to why your firm should be considered. All interested firms must respond by 2:00 PM (EST), June 19, 2006, to Carol Elliott, National Nuclear Security Administration, Y-12 Site Office, P.O. Box 2050, Oak Ridge, TN 37831 or E-Mail at elliottcr@yso.doe.gov. A determination not to compete this proposed contract extension is solely within the discretion of the Government. Information received will normally be considered solely for the purpose of determining whether to conduct a competitive procurement. No reimbursement for any costs connected with providing capability information will be provided by NNSA.
